Overlooking the Ouvèze valley, the village clings to the hillside. The discovery of vestiges in the latter, shows that Rasteau was a well-to-do residential place in Roman times. A burial place with rich furniture was thus discovered with various objects nowadays exposed in the Calvet Museum in Avignon. In the Middle Ages, Bishop Pierre II of Mirabel was its spiritual and temporal lord (1009). The estate passed into papal possession in 1274.
